"Finally," a curriculum that promotes academic excellence and personal safety, while giving students the skills to make connections that matter!Based on the #1 "New York Times" bestseller "The 5 Love Languages"(R), this curriculum uses research-based techniques that will help teachers and students establish both human and academic connections. Inside you'll find:



  • Eight easy-to-use lessons written in both scripted and abbreviated formats (average time per lesson: 35 minutes)

  • Curriculum that reaches all elementary-aged students, including trauma-sensitive, complex, and highly capable learners

  • Instruction that connects students with their teachers, educational staff, peers, and family at the deepest levels of understanding

  • Academic Focus Pages(TM) written at age-appropriate levels. Students can use them during the lesson and the classroom teacher can reproduce them year after year

  • Tools and ideas for all staff members to create an overall school climate of acceptance and break down walls of diversity


Thoroughly field-tested, this material has been taught in many classrooms-public and private-with outstanding results. It reads like a book, with interesting stories and insights that dive deep into what it means to truly connect with students.

GARY CHAPMAN, PhD, is the author of the #1 New York Times bestselling The 5 Love Languages. With over 30 years of counseling experience, he has the uncanny ability to hold a mirror up to human behavior, showing readers not just where they go wrong, but also how to grow and move forward. Dr. Chapman holds BA and MA degrees in anthropology from Wheaton College and Wake Forest University, respectively, MRE and PhD degrees from Southwestern Baptist Theological Seminary, and has completed postgraduate work at the University of North Carolina and Duke University. DM FREED, M.Ed. is a former elementary teacher and has been employed for the last 18 years as a school counselor with Central Valley School District. He holds an Elementary Education Degree from Boise State University and two Masters Degrees in education from Whitworth University. His school and district have been recognized with numerous awards by Washington State for "Outstanding Educational Excellence." D.M. believes that a student's academic success hinges on the positive relationships they build with other students, their family and school faculty.
